Why SaaS ERP training governance has become a core implementation discipline
In enterprise SaaS ERP programs, training can no longer be treated as a late-stage enablement task. Distributed workforces, accelerated release cycles, and continuous process redesign have made training governance a central part of implementation lifecycle management. When organizations migrate from legacy ERP to cloud platforms, the challenge is not only teaching users where to click. It is governing how new workflows are understood, adopted, measured, and sustained across regions, business units, and operating models.
This is especially true for enterprises managing rapid process change. A procurement workflow may be redesigned during deployment. Finance controls may be standardized globally after initial configuration. Warehouse teams may receive mobile-first process updates after go-live. Without a formal training governance model, these changes create fragmented adoption, inconsistent execution, and elevated operational risk.
For CIOs, COOs, PMO leaders, and enterprise architects, the implication is clear: SaaS ERP training governance is part of transformation execution, not a downstream communications activity. It must align with rollout governance, cloud migration controls, operational readiness frameworks, and business process harmonization.
The enterprise problem: distributed teams plus rapid change create adoption volatility
Traditional ERP training models assumed stable processes, centralized teams, and infrequent software change. SaaS ERP environments break those assumptions. Teams are distributed across time zones, contractors and shared services are embedded into core operations, and process owners are often refining workflows while implementation is still underway. In this environment, static training manuals and one-time classroom sessions fail quickly.
The operational impact is measurable. Users revert to local workarounds, approvals bypass intended controls, reporting becomes inconsistent, and support tickets rise after each release. Program teams then misdiagnose the issue as user resistance, when the root cause is often weak governance over training content, role alignment, process versioning, and deployment timing.
A global manufacturer, for example, may deploy a cloud ERP template for order-to-cash across North America and EMEA. If regional teams receive different training interpretations of pricing overrides, credit holds, and exception handling, the enterprise does not have one process. It has multiple local variants operating under the same system label. That undermines workflow standardization and weakens the value of the ERP modernization program.
| Implementation condition | Training governance gap | Operational consequence |
|---|---|---|
| Distributed rollout across regions | No role-based content ownership | Inconsistent process execution |
| Rapid SaaS release cadence | Training not linked to change control | Post-release confusion and ticket spikes |
| Legacy to cloud migration | Old process habits not retired | Shadow workflows and compliance risk |
| Shared services expansion | Onboarding not standardized | Variable productivity and quality |
What training governance means in a modern ERP implementation
Training governance is the operating model that controls how learning content, process changes, role readiness, and adoption evidence are managed throughout the ERP modernization lifecycle. It defines who owns training decisions, how content is approved, how process changes trigger enablement updates, how readiness is measured, and how local deviations are escalated.
In mature programs, training governance sits between design authority and operational adoption. It translates approved process models into role-specific learning pathways, links release management to enablement updates, and ensures that deployment orchestration includes measurable readiness gates. This is what separates enterprise transformation execution from basic software onboarding.
- Establish a training governance board with representation from process owners, deployment leads, HR enablement, IT, and regional operations.
- Tie all training content to approved process versions, control narratives, and role definitions rather than generic system features.
- Integrate training updates into release management, testing cycles, and cutover planning so enablement changes are not handled informally.
- Use readiness metrics such as completion, proficiency validation, exception rates, and post-go-live support trends instead of attendance alone.
- Define escalation paths for local process deviations, language localization issues, and role conflicts during rollout.
A governance model for distributed SaaS ERP training
A practical governance model has four layers. First is policy governance, where the enterprise defines standards for role mapping, content approval, localization, and evidence retention. Second is process governance, where each end-to-end workflow owner validates what users must learn and what changes require retraining. Third is deployment governance, where regional rollout teams sequence training according to cutover waves, business calendars, and operational continuity constraints. Fourth is performance governance, where adoption data is reviewed to identify weak process uptake and emerging risk.
This layered model matters because distributed teams do not fail for one reason. Some struggle because content is outdated. Others because local managers do not reinforce new workflows. Others because process changes are approved too late for training teams to respond. Governance creates a common control structure across these variables.

How cloud ERP migration changes the training equation
Cloud ERP migration introduces a different training burden than on-premise replacement. The system is not static after go-live. Quarterly updates, evolving controls, embedded analytics, and workflow automation continuously reshape user behavior. As a result, training governance must support both migration readiness and ongoing modernization.
During migration, enterprises often underestimate the cognitive shift required. Users are not only learning a new interface. They are moving from local exceptions to standardized workflows, from spreadsheet-based reconciliation to system-driven controls, and from informal approvals to auditable digital processes. Training must therefore explain why the process changed, what control objective it supports, and how the new workflow affects upstream and downstream teams.
Consider a services company migrating finance and procurement to SaaS ERP while retaining a legacy project system temporarily. If training focuses only on the new ERP screens, users will not understand cross-system dependencies, timing differences, or interim reconciliation steps. Governance ensures that transitional operating models are documented, taught, and retired in a controlled way.
Training governance should be built around workflows, not modules
One of the most common implementation mistakes is organizing training by ERP module rather than by business workflow. Module-based training mirrors the software architecture, but users operate in end-to-end processes. A planner cares about forecast-to-produce. A buyer cares about requisition-to-pay. A finance analyst cares about record-to-report. Governance should therefore anchor enablement to workflow standardization and business process harmonization.
This approach improves operational adoption because it clarifies handoffs, exceptions, and accountability. It also supports connected enterprise operations by showing how one team's actions affect another team's data quality, cycle time, and control posture. In distributed organizations, that cross-functional visibility is essential for reducing fragmentation.
| Training design choice | Short-term benefit | Long-term enterprise outcome |
|---|---|---|
| Module-based training | Faster content production | Weak process understanding |
| Role-based training | Better relevance for users | Improved task execution |
| Workflow-based training | Stronger cross-functional context | Higher standardization and resilience |
| Scenario-based reinforcement | Better exception handling | Lower post-go-live disruption |
Implementation scenarios that expose governance maturity
Scenario one is a rapid acquisition integration. A company acquires a regional distributor and needs to onboard 600 users into its SaaS ERP template within 90 days. Without governance, the acquired entity receives generic training that ignores local tax handling, warehouse exceptions, and customer service escalation paths. With governance, the enterprise maps inherited roles to the target operating model, identifies temporary process variances, and deploys controlled onboarding with measurable readiness thresholds.
Scenario two is a global process redesign after initial go-live. A retailer standardizes inventory adjustments and store replenishment rules across five countries. If training is decentralized, each country interprets the change differently and reporting comparability declines. If governance is centralized but locally coordinated, process owners approve one global narrative, regional leads localize examples, and adoption metrics are reviewed by wave.
Scenario three is a quarterly SaaS release that changes approval routing and introduces embedded analytics. Enterprises with weak governance often communicate the update through email and assume managers will cascade the change. Mature programs update role-based learning assets, run targeted reinforcement for impacted approvers, and monitor exception rates for 30 days after release.
Metrics that matter for operational adoption and resilience
Executive teams should avoid equating training completion with readiness. Completion is useful, but it does not prove operational capability. A stronger measurement model combines learning evidence with process performance and support indicators. This creates implementation observability and allows PMOs to intervene before adoption issues become operational disruption.
- Role readiness: percentage of in-scope users validated against role-specific tasks before cutover.
- Process adherence: rate of transactions executed through the standardized workflow versus local workarounds.
- Exception quality: frequency and type of approval bypasses, manual corrections, and policy deviations after go-live.
- Support stabilization: ticket volume, repeat issue patterns, and time to proficiency by role and region.
- Change absorption: adoption performance after each release or process update, not only at initial deployment.
Executive recommendations for governing training in high-change ERP environments
First, assign executive ownership. Training governance should report into the ERP transformation office or implementation governance structure, not operate as an isolated learning workstream. This ensures that process decisions, release timing, and readiness risks are visible at the program level.
Second, fund training as operational infrastructure. Enterprises often underinvest in content maintenance, localization, and reinforcement because they view training as a one-time launch cost. In SaaS ERP, training is part of the operating model. Budgeting should reflect ongoing release enablement, onboarding for new hires, and process change reinforcement.
Third, standardize the minimum viable learning architecture across all rollout waves. That includes role taxonomy, workflow narratives, scenario libraries, assessment methods, and readiness dashboards. Local teams can adapt examples, but the governance model should preserve enterprise consistency.
Fourth, connect training governance to operational continuity planning. If a critical function such as payroll, order fulfillment, or month-end close is affected by process change, the training plan should include fallback procedures, hypercare staffing, and escalation protocols. This is where adoption strategy directly supports resilience.
The strategic outcome: training governance as a modernization accelerator
When training governance is designed well, it does more than improve user confidence. It accelerates enterprise modernization by reducing process drift, strengthening rollout governance, and making cloud ERP change sustainable at scale. It also improves the economics of transformation. Fewer support escalations, faster time to proficiency, and stronger workflow compliance all contribute to better implementation ROI.
For distributed enterprises, this capability becomes a competitive advantage. Organizations can absorb acquisitions faster, deploy global process changes with less disruption, and maintain connected operations despite continuous software evolution. In that sense, SaaS ERP training governance is not simply about learning. It is a control system for operational adoption, implementation scalability, and modernization resilience.
